Output 3cd11fbbdafdf7531cb53c08f5d07c8f6dfc8d91015ccb968c1065075fa2f23e:0

value
343321
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6ab7d356c2aeb970e8a9a2ac87d1f746c3066a86 OP_EQUAL
address
3BRHmJNnDV7YKn61qAvMPiiT8RXJmTE8Qr
transaction
3cd11fbbdafdf7531cb53c08f5d07c8f6dfc8d91015ccb968c1065075fa2f23e
confirmations
322160
spent
true